Uniprot | TISSUE SPECIFICITY: Expressed in roots and at low levels in buds and leaves. Not expressed in cell culture. {ECO:0000269|PubMed:7756828}. |

UniProt | Acts as a transcriptional activator and may be involved in disease resistance pathways. Binds to the GCC-box pathogenesis-related promoter element. Involved in the regulation of gene expression by stress factors and by components of stress signal transduction pathways mediated by ethylene, that seems to depend on a protein kinase cascade, and to be influenced by methyl-jasmonate. {ECO:0000269|PubMed:10652129, ECO:0000269|PubMed:10792818, ECO:0000269|PubMed:7756828, ECO:0000269|Ref.2}. |

UniProt | INDUCTION: Induced by ethephon (ethylene-releasing compound) in buds and to a lower extent in leaves. Strongly induced by cycloheximide and mechanical stimuli. Wounding leads to a both local and systemic expression, independently of ethylene, and through a de-novo-protein-synthesis-independent regulation. Wound induction is reduced by methyl-jasmonate. Induction by purified xylanase from Trichoderma viride (TvX) and another elicitor from Phytophthora infestans (PiE), that appears to be mediated by both protein kinases and protein phosphatases. {ECO:0000269|PubMed:10652129, ECO:0000269|PubMed:12090623, ECO:0000269|PubMed:7756828, ECO:0000269|Ref.2}. |
